Rotary Encoders

Rotary Encoders provide alternative to resolvers.

Rotary Encoders are available in singleturn version, ECI 1317 which counts 17 bits, 131,072 measuring steps per revolution; and multiturn EQI 1329 with 4096 distinguishable revolutions (12 bits). Units feature inductive scanning principle and EnDat interface. They are designed for servomotor and general applications.

Rotary Encoders

Hollow-Shaft Encoders are intrinsically safe.

Model HS35 (3.5 in. dia) and HS25 (2.5 in. dia) are available with Class I, Division 1, Group C and D ratings when connected to appropriate electrical barriers. Both models feature RS422 compatible output. Encoders can be mounted directly to shafts with diameters ranging from 1/4 to 1 in. Rotary Encoder is designed for large shafts.
Rotary Encoders

Rotary Encoder is designed for large shafts.

Designed for shafts with axes requiring accuracies to approximately 10 angular seconds, ERM 280 modular rotary encoder with magnetic scanning, features 20mm high scanning head. Magneto-resistive scanning permits shaft speeds up to 24,000 rpm, and is available for shaft diameters up to 295 mm (11.6 in.). Encoder features protection class IP 66.
